I will never forget the first time i visit the square. it was 2011and i found an apocalyptic landscape. lot of people congregated around capsized ambulances and trash trucks, police cars destroyed...it took me while realized that there were filming the movie world war z and the place was transformed to look like a us city. in any case, it worth visiting and enjoy the view of the buildings around. if you are lucky you can find an event with music, craft and good street food.
The centre of glasgow. it has key architectural buildings as well as statues of many important scottish figures including robert burns, james watt etc.
George square is a vibrant city centre location surrounded by impressive architecture and statues of famous figures. you can take a guided tour of city chambers, enjoy lunch in the square, or enjoy an outdoor event in one of the many festivals held there throughout the year. the area also offers an array of shopping, dining, and entertainment options, making it the perfect day out in glasgow.
